🌹 Happy Valentine’s Day! Want to impress someone in Russian today? Here are 5 ways to say "I like you" in Russian! šŸ’• ā£ 1. "Ты мне Š½Ń€Š°ĢŠ²ŠøŃˆŃŒŃŃ." (Ty mnye NRA-veesh-sya) šŸ‘‰ Neutral but flirty šŸ˜‰ – The most common way to say ā€œI like youā€. Perfect for early romance! šŸ’– 2. "ŠÆ Šŗ тебе Š½ŠµŃ€Š°Š²Š½Š¾Š“ŃƒĢŃˆŠµŠ½/Š½ŠµŃ€Š°Š²Š½Š¾Š“ŃƒĢŃˆŠ½Š°." (Ya k te-BYE ne-rav-na-DÚ-shen / ne-rav-na-DÚ-shna) šŸ‘‰ Deep and poetic – Literally means "I am not indifferent to you." A heartfelt way to express admiration, ideal for Valentine’s Day! šŸ’ž 3. "Ты покори́л(а) моё се́рГце." (Ty pa-ka-REEL(a) ma-YO SYƉRD-tse) šŸ‘‰ Romantic and dramatic – ā€œYou have conquered my heart.ā€ Sounds like something from a classic novel. Perfect for writing in a Valentine’s card! šŸ”„ 4. "Ты свóГишь Š¼ŠµŠ½ŃĢ с ума́!" (Ty SVƓ-deesh men-YƁ s u-MƁ) šŸ‘‰ Passionate and intense šŸ˜ – "You drive me crazy!" Great for dramatic love confessions today. šŸ’” 5. "Без Ń‚ŠµŠ±ŃĢ Š¼Š¾ŃĢ жизнь не та." (Bez te-BYƁ ma-YƁ ZHEEZN’ ne TA) šŸ‘‰ For deep love – "Without you, my life is not the same."
